Frequently asked questions about Teravista El
How many students attend Teravista El?
Teravista El has 821 students enrolled. It is a public school in Round Rock, TX. CCD year-over-year: 789 (2022-23) → 826 (2023-24), nearly flat (+37).
What is the student-teacher ratio at Teravista El?
The student-teacher ratio at Teravista El is 14.9:1, which is 1% higher than the Texas average of 14.7:1 and 5% lower than the national average of 15.7:1.
What percentage of students receive free lunch at Teravista El?
15.2% of students at Teravista El are eligible for free lunch, compared to the Texas average of 61.9%.
What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Teravista El?
The largest demographic group at Teravista El is White at 37.4% of enrollment, in Round Rock, TX. Its student body is more racially and ethnically mixed than most US schools, with a diversity index of 74.9/100.
What is the Resource Investment Index for Teravista El?
Teravista El has a Resource Investment Index of 46/100 (typical reported resources relative to schools nationally) based on 4 factors: student-teacher ratio, gifted-program reporting, counselor availability, chronic absenteeism. Not a test-score or academic measure (national median ~41/100, see methodology).
